Algorithmic Dilemmas
- Algorithmic dilemmas are challenges and ethical issues that arise from the use of algorithms.
- While algorithms offer efficiency and consistency, they can also lead to unintended consequences, such as bias, lack of transparency, and the erosion of human judgment.
Algorithmic Bias and Fairness
A systematic error in a computer system and/or algorithm that creates unfair outcomes, such as, but not limited to, privileging one group over others.
Causes of Algorithmic Bias
- Biased Data: Algorithms trained on historical data that reflect societal biases will perpetuate those biases.
- Design Choices: Developers may unintentionally embed their own biases into the algorithm.
- Lack of Diversity: Homogeneous teams may overlook biases that affect underrepresented groups.
Amazon's Recruitment Tool: In 2018, Amazon had to scrap a recruitment algorithm that favouredmale candidates because it was trained on historicaldata from a male-dominatedworkforce.
Fairness in Algorithms
- Equal Treatment: Ensuring that the algorithm performs consistently across all groups.
- Outcome Fairness: Ensuring that the results of the algorithm are equitable for all groups.
- Bias Audits: Regularly testing algorithms for bias and making adjustments as needed.
COMPAS Algorithm: Used in the U.S. for criminal risk assessment, it was found to disproportionatelyassignhigher risk scores to Blackdefendants, leading to harshersentences.
Algorithmic Accountability and Transparency
The responsibility of developers and organizations to ensure that algorithms are fair, transparent, and explainable.
Black Box Algorithms
- An algorithm whose internal workings are not visible or understandable to users.
- The algorithm accepts input, and returns relevant output, but it is unknown how that output was produced.
- Lack of Transparency: Users cannot see how decisions are made, making it difficult to identify errors or biases.
- Accountability Issues: When an algorithm fails or causes harm, it's unclear who is responsible.
Facebook's News Feed Algorithm: The algorithm prioritizescontent based on userengagement, but the exactcriteriaare unknown, leading to concernsabout misinformationand echochambers.
Transparency in Algorithms
- Explainable: Making algorithms understandable to users and stakeholders.
- Open Source: Sharing the algorithm's code to allow for external review.
- Regulations: Laws like the GDPR in Europe require organizations to explain automated decisions to users.
Transparency is especially important in critical areas like healthcare, finance, and criminal justice, where algorithmic decisions can have significant impacts.
Erosion and/or Loss of Human Judgment
- Automation: Algorithms can replace human decision-making in areas like hiring, loan approval, and law enforcement.
- Overreliance: Trusting algorithms blindly can lead to errors and reduce human oversight.
- Loss of Skills: As algorithms take over tasks, humans may lose the ability to perform them manually.
Autonomous Vehicles: While self-driving cars can reduce accidents, overreliance on automation could diminish drivers' skills and judgment in emergency situations.
Theory of KnowledgeTo what extent should we trust algorithms to make decisions that affect people's lives?
Self review- Can you explain how algorithmic bias occurs and its impacts?
- What are the challenges of black box algorithms?
- How can transparency and accountability be ensured in algorithmic systems?